How much does an inventory specialist earn in Vancouver, WA?
The average inventory specialist in Vancouver, WA earns between $27,000 and $52,000 annually. This compares to the national average inventory specialist range of $25,000 to $49,000.
Average inventory specialist salary in Vancouver, WA
$38,000
